Graphic Packaging International Launches Paperboard ProducePack
Graphic Packaging International has introduced ProducePack, a sustainable paperboard packaging range of solutions for fresh produce. Aligned with Graphic Packaging’s Vision 2025 to be better stewards for the environment, the innovative carton offers brands and retailers an eco-friendly solution for a variety of applications with an artisan look that protects, preserves and presents fresh produce, from field […]
DS Smith’s Greentote Is 100% Recyclable Alternative To Plastic Bags
As more states, counties and cities ban plastic bags, DS Smith now is offering grocery stores and consumers Greentote, the first reusable, moisture-resistant, modular, 100 percent recyclable container made from renewable resources. Food Lion Donates More than $106K To Support No Kid Hungry
Salisbury, North Carolina-based Food Lion Feeds has donated more than $106,000 in child feeding grants to No Kid Hungry to support the campaign’s mission to end child hunger. Alabama Grocers Association Honors Front-Line Heroes
On Feb. 22, the Alabama Grocers Association joined supermarkets and food manufacturers nationwide in celebrating the first Supermarket Employee Day. The Food Industry Association (FMI) proclaimed this new holiday to recognize employees at every level for the work they do feeding families and enriching lives.
